Zoroastrianism

Zoroastrianism is an ancient Iranian religion that is still practiced today by a small number of people. It is one of the world’s oldest monotheistic religions, and its teachings have had a profound impact on other religions, such as JudaismJudaism, ChristianityChristianity, and IslamIslam.
